Well Spacing
refers to the
Strategic placement of wells
in a reservoir to optimize
Resource Extraction
while minimizing economic and
Environmental Impacts
. It is critical to ensure that the wells are neither too closely spaced, which can lead to
Pressure Interference
and
Reduced efficiency
, nor too far apart, which could leave
Valuable resources unrecovered
.
